Report: Junior Galette to miss majority of season with ankle injury

Redskins 'lose Galette for most of season'

The Washington Redskins will be without new signing Junior Galette for the majority of the season due to injury, according to reports.

The three-time Super Bowl champions snapped up the defensive end from the New Orleans Saints in the off-season, but he suffered an ankle injury in practice yesterday.

NFL Media claims that Galette has torn his Achilles tendon, and will miss most of the campaign as a result.

The 27-year-old has made 31.5 sacks in his career.
